Ayuna Hattori is a scholar working on Molecular Biology, Hematology and Biochemistry. According to data from OpenAlex, Ayuna Hattori has authored 17 papers receiving a total of 496 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 14 papers in Molecular Biology, 5 papers in Hematology and 4 papers in Biochemistry. Recurrent topics in Ayuna Hattori's work include Metabolomics and Mass Spectrometry Studies (4 papers), Amino Acid Enzymes and Metabolism (3 papers) and Acute Myeloid Leukemia Research (3 papers). Ayuna Hattori is often cited by papers focused on Metabolomics and Mass Spectrometry Studies (4 papers), Amino Acid Enzymes and Metabolism (3 papers) and Acute Myeloid Leukemia Research (3 papers). Ayuna Hattori collaborates with scholars based in Japan, United States and United Kingdom. Ayuna Hattori's co-authors include Takahiro Ito, Makoto Tsunoda, Daniel McSkimming, Arthur S. Edison, Fariba Tayyari, Natarajan Kannan, Arinobu Tojo, Takaaki Konuma, Tamás Nagy and John Glushka and has published in prestigious journals such as Nature, SHILAP Revista de lepidopterología and Annals of Oncology.
